Subject: Change to criteria for membership certification: Last Verified Date

 

Dear DPCA Voting Members,

On August 30, the DPCA ExCom adopted a plan to add the Last Verified Date field of membership database records to the criteria for counting members to determine the votes allocated to representatives of Country Committees regarding DPCA matters.

Section 5.4(d) of the DA Charter reads: "The Executive Committee shall establish from time to time the methods and procedures to be used by the Country Committees to verify and certify membership for all purposes under this Charter, with the maximum accuracy reasonably possible for an association such as Democrats Abroad.”

In the past, this meant counting the number of membership records assigned to a Country Committee and excluding records based on now-familiar criteria such as missing an address and a local phone number. Beginning with the membership count to be conducted in January 2015, an additional condition for counting a membership record will be: a Last Verified Date of no more than four (4) years from the date of the relevant count/snapshot.

Specifically, for the next membership certification process, a member shall count toward the allocation of votes to a Country Committee in 2015 only if the member’s database record has a Last Verified Date later than January 31, 2011.

The Last Verified Date (LVD) proposal was formally proposed and presented at the April 2013 DPCA Global Meeting in London. During the January 2014 certification process of membership counts, the International Secretary distributed LVD counts for each Country Committee. The LVD adoption plan was presented again at the March 2014 DPCA Global Meeting in Washington - Crystal City. Most recently, Shari posted guidelines for the LVD field on August 4 on the DPCA-Leadership listserv. 

The LVD feature of our membership database places a focus on having accurate, verifiable data on reliable Democratic voters. This is the same focus that we have seen throughout the Democratic Party, from being a key to OFA’s success in 2008 through to the overwhelming adoption by the DNC, state parties, and individual candidates for this year’s campaigns.

There is an additional benefit that may increase membership counts in the long run. In the past, Country Admins and Country Committee officers have deleted suspect records of members who couldn’t be reached. There was no middle ground between certifying a valid member and removing a member permanently.

The LVD criterion lifts the assumption that Country Committee officers certify the status of all members, regardless of when they were last contacted. Thus, it allows Country Committee officers to retain any number of records for follow-up and eliminates the practice of a hasty “cull” of suspect records just before certification deadlines. The set of membership records with “old” LVD dates are now a resource that can be tapped when time is available, rather than a liability to be excised in January of each year.
